Ruby语言入门教程:从安装到基础语法详解

需积分: 13 0 下载量 128 浏览量 更新于2024-07-29 1 收藏 1.05MB PDF 举报
"Ruby语言入门教程v1.0是一份针对初学者的中文文档,旨在帮助读者快速理解并掌握这门编程语言。该教程主要分为五个章节: 1. 自序部分介绍了编程语言的发展历史,强调编程的易学性,并讲述了Ruby语言的起源和发展背景,包括其独特的设计哲学和特点。 2. 第一章概述了如何下载和安装Ruby 1.8.5版本,适合Windows用户,以及如何编写和运行第一个Ruby程序,让读者体验到编程的基础操作。同时,还提到了Ruby的集成开发环境(IDE),这对于开发环境的选择和配置具有指导意义。 3. 语法快览是教学的核心部分,涵盖了基础概念如注释、分隔符、关键字、运算符、标识名和变量作用域等。此外,详细讲解了各种条件判断语句(如if、unless、case)、循环结构(while、until、for、break/next/retry等)、异常处理和线程,通过实例演示加深理解。 4. 第四章深入探讨了Ruby的面向对象特性,区分了两种不同的思维方式——过程式编程和面向对象编程,帮助读者理解Ruby中的万物皆对象这一核心概念。 5. 结尾部分提供了一个综合小练习,旨在检验读者对前面章节所学知识的掌握程度,同时也激发他们的实践兴趣。 该教程语言简洁易懂,注重实践操作,适合初学者系统学习Ruby语言,无论是对编程感兴趣的新手,还是想要扩展技能的开发者,都能从中获益匪浅。"